Comprehensive Guide to Eurolabs EPA 8325B Detection of Pesticide Compounds in Stormwater Testing Service

The detection of pesticide compounds in stormwater is a critical aspect of environmental monitoring, particularly in urban and agricultural areas. The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has established guidelines for the analysis of these pollutants through the publication of Method 8325B. This method is designed to detect and quantify pesticide residues in stormwater samples.

    Eurolabs EPA 8325B testing service involves a comprehensive process:

    1. Sample collection: stormwater samples are collected from various sources using standardized protocols.

    2. Preparation: samples are prepared for analysis by removing interfering substances.

    3. Analysis: pesticide residues are detected and quantified using g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S).

    4. Data analysis: results are analyzed to determine the concentration of pesticide residues.
